
Techstars announces new Web3 accelerator based in Boston
Techstars, the global investment business that provides access to capital, one-on-one mentorship, and customized programming for early-stage entrepreneurs, has announced a new accelerator program.
Titled “Techstars Crypto Boston powered by Algorand,” the new program will accept 12 Web3-focused start-ups each of the next three years. Web3 is an internet that uses blockchain, cryptocurrencies and non-fungible tokens (NFTs) to give users control and ownership of online assets.
The three-month program’s first cohort will begin their experience in January, and Techstars is currently accepting applications for the inaugural class. The application deadline is September 14. Techstars is seeking companies focused on sustainable blockchain technology to power the economic models of the future.
Program sponsor Algorand describes itself as providing the “world’s most decentralized, scalable, and secure blockchain infrastructure.”
